Mifi Tool is a Windows-based utility software designed primarily for servicing mobile routers (MiFi devices), smartphones, and tablets. Unlike all-in-one boxes (like the Easy JTAG or Octoplus Box), Mifi Tool focuses on a specific niche: unlocking, resetting, and repairing portable WiFi modems and Android devices via diagnostic ports.
